But Chad, to answer your question, if you're gonna root, you might as well try out some of the custom gingerbread roms we have on this forum. There are Audiophile, valhalla and ICBINB. There are differences to all of them so make sure you read up on which you might wanna flash.
Superoneclick can't root our phones on Gingerbread, so you'll need to flash a custom GB kernel as Exodian recommended.
If you want you can follow my GB starter pack guide from step 7 on so you can prepare your phone for having ext4 and a gingerbread rom of your choice without issues.
